Jump to content

All my products and services are free. All my costs are met by donations I receive from my users. If you enjoy using any of my products, please donate to support me. Thank you for your support. Tom Speirs

Patreon

Atomiswave anyone?


Brian Hoffman

Recommended Posts

  • Replies 68
  • Created
  • Last Reply

Top Posters In This Topic

Awesome. :blink: Is it possible to overclock the emulator to get less slowdowns compared to the real hardware? I remember from when I had an Atomiswave mobo with Dolphin Blue that the slowdowns was on par with Metal Slug 2.

Link to comment
Share on other sites

Awesome. :blink: Is it possible to overclock the emulator to get less slowdowns compared to the real hardware? I remember from when I had an Atomiswave mobo with Dolphin Blue that the slowdowns was on par with Metal Slug 2.

Hmm, Im not sure if you can, it may produce less than desirable results to try and increase the clock speed on the sh4 and stuff. The games played fine for me, consequently Dolphin Blue is made from the same guy that produced 4 of the metal slug games. :)

Link to comment
Share on other sites

  • 3 weeks later...

Works great, thanks.

Don't suppose you could knock up a wrapper for the Naomi side of Demul to work in GameEx could you?

or maybe send me the script for the Atomiswave wrapper so I could edit it to play Naomi.

No worries if not, thanks again.

Link to comment
Share on other sites

Works great, thanks.

Don't suppose you could knock up a wrapper for the Naomi side of Demul to work in GameEx could you?

or maybe send me the script for the Atomiswave wrapper so I could edit it to play Naomi.

No worries if not, thanks again.

Sweet! I am glad you found it useful.

I really do not mind posting the code, I made it on my other pc, so when I fire it up I will post it if you are still interested.

In my opnion. MAKARON T12 is much better for Naomi, for stablity and compatibility. It will also load via Gameex without a loader.

Naomi.exe "[rompath]\[romfile]"

Link to comment
Share on other sites

A little late on replying but the loader works perfectly! Is there any sort of database to use? I'll give the MAME database a whirl and see what happens. Btw weird thing happen while selecting fotns (Fists of the north star) it loads some deer hunting game :P

Link to comment
Share on other sites

A little late on replying but the loader works perfectly! Is there any sort of database to use? I'll give the MAME database a whirl and see what happens. Btw weird thing happen while selecting fotns (Fists of the north star) it loads some deer hunting game :P

There is an INI that you can edit, for each rom it sends the DOWN ARROW "x" amount of times, perhaps I typed the wrong number, go ahead and just edit the INI. Glad you find it usefull.

Link to comment
Share on other sites

There is an INI that you can edit, for each rom it sends the DOWN ARROW "x" amount of times, perhaps I typed the wrong number, go ahead and just edit the INI. Glad you find it usefull.

Thanks for replying! Though I'm not rally sure what to change here. Also is there a datebase for Atomiswave? The MAME one doesn't seem to work :P

Link to comment
Share on other sites

Sweet! I am glad you found it useful.

I really do not mind posting the code, I made it on my other pc, so when I fire it up I will post it if you are still interested.

In my opnion. MAKARON T12 is much better for Naomi, for stablity and compatibility. It will also load via Gameex without a loader.

Naomi.exe "[rompath]\[romfile]"

Yea I'm using Makaron T12 for the Naomi 1 games and it is great but its just for the Naomi 2 games that makaron doesn't support yet.

If its no bother then if you could post the script that would be fantastic, no rush tho I'm off to work now anyway.

Thanks.

Link to comment
Share on other sites

Thanks for replying! Though I'm not rally sure what to change here. Also is there a datebase for Atomiswave? The MAME one doesn't seem to work :P

The settings.ini is what you update to fix the ROM launching the wrong one. Launch Demul outside gameex, choose load atomiswave, Press Down till you get the game you want to load, that will be your down count. Edit the settings ini accordingly.

As far as I know there is no databasse for atomiswave yet, but with only a handfull of games it should be pretty easy to make, or at least a map file to give the roms friendly names.

Link to comment
Share on other sites

Yea I'm using Makaron T12 for the Naomi 1 games and it is great but its just for the Naomi 2 games that makaron doesn't support yet.

If its no bother then if you could post the script that would be fantastic, no rush tho I'm off to work now anyway.

Thanks.

I'am at work now too, I will post it tonight.

Link to comment
Share on other sites

The settings.ini is what you update to fix the ROM launching the wrong one. Launch Demul outside gameex, choose load atomiswave, Press Down till you get the game you want to load, that will be your down count. Edit the settings ini accordingly.

As far as I know there is no databasse for atomiswave yet, but with only a handfull of games it should be pretty easy to make, or at least a map file to give the roms friendly names.

Thanks Brian! I'll give it a try. Yeah it shouldn't be too hard you're right. I can't wait till Metal Slug 6 is dumped :D
Link to comment
Share on other sites

Perhaps, does Nulldc not work for you? I thought NullDC was more compatible for Dreamcast Games.

Thats just it I dont like nulldc that much plus Demul i honestly think other than the sound is surpassing nulldc in dc games.. Take Ikaruga for example. Try running it of null then demul and you will see the difference... Besides the fact that Nulldc seems to be abandoned by the author. He works on porting it to the psp now but never updates it...

Link to comment
Share on other sites

I have never played ms6 on arcades, dolphin blue is very fun and feels just like the mslug series.

I've only ever played the Ps2 version of MS6. I'll have to give Dolphin Blue a try. Oh Brian I tried your suggestion of changing the down count but it still seems to launch a different game :lol:

Link to comment
Share on other sites

I've only ever played the Ps2 version of MS6. I'll have to give Dolphin Blue a try. Oh Brian I tried your suggestion of changing the down count but it still seems to launch a different game :lol:

The same game or a diffrent one? See if the game it is selecting is above or below the one your trying to run. then change accordingly.

Link to comment
Share on other sites

The same game or a diffrent one? See if the game it is selecting is above or below the one your trying to run. then change accordingly.

It was a different one this time. So it seems changing the count is working. I'll give it a shot thanks!

Link to comment
Share on other sites

I wouldnt mind a loader for the Naomi and DC side of this emu. I think its the best out there.... I tryed Makaron T12 i wasent too impressed with it i still prefer demul... BTW there is a version 5.5 of Demul out now. Its not of the offical site yet but if you look around you can find it easy.

Link to comment
Share on other sites

I wouldnt mind a loader for the Naomi and DC side of this emu. I think its the best out there.... I tryed Makaron T12 i wasent too impressed with it i still prefer demul... BTW there is a version 5.5 of Demul out now. Its not of the offical site yet but if you look around you can find it easy.

Yea I grabbed that the first day it was out, last week some time. I will post the loaders source code. If you or Hunk 4th wants to edit it to do Naomi and DC thats fine. I'd offer but with dreamcast having over 300 games I do not feel like making entry's in an INI for all games.

:)

It was a different one this time. So it seems changing the count is working. I'll give it a shot thanks!

Are you using the version of Demul that I packaged with the loader? Diffrent versions could lead to the diffrent games launching. The version I posted was a unofficial one.

Link to comment
Share on other sites

Yea I grabbed that the first day it was out, last week some time. I will post the loaders source code. If you or Hunk 4th wants to edit it to do Naomi and DC thats fine. I'd offer but with dreamcast having over 300 games I do not feel like making entry's in an INI for all games. I think it would difficult to do Dreamcast like Brian said, there are well over 300 titles for this console :P

:)

Are you using the version of Demul that I packaged with the loader? Diffrent versions could lead to the diffrent games launching. The version I posted was a unofficial one.

I bet that's it. I was using the latest one. damn I didn't think of that. I'll give that a shot.

*EDIT* Yeah, that's what it was. Thanks for mentioning this! :)

Link to comment
Share on other sites

As promised, here is the source. Use it well.


#NoEnv
#SingleInstance force
#Persistent
#NoTrayIcon

;CHECKING FOR 1 PARAMS, IF NOT THEN EXIT
if 0 < 1
{
MsgBox Usage: DEMUL_Loader.exe "romfile"
ExitApp
}
DetectHiddenWindows, On
Blockinput on ; Keeps users from messing up loader my pressing buttons and moving mouse
RomName = %1% ; error level (rompath romfile) gives friendly name as ROM


SetBatchLines -1


MouseMove %A_ScreenWidth%,%A_ScreenHeight%
Gui +AlwaysOnTop -Caption +ToolWindow ; No title, No taskbar icon
Gui Color, 0 ; Color Black
Gui Show, x0 y0 h%A_ScreenHeight% w%A_ScreenWidth%, HSHIDE
WinHide ahk_class Shell_TrayWnd
WinHide Start ahk_class Button
;WinSet Transparent, 200, A ; Can be semi-transparent
MouseGetPos X, Y ; Remember pos to return
MouseMove %A_ScreenWidth%,%A_ScreenHeight% ; Move pointer off
IniRead, num_down, %A_WorkingDir%\settings.ini, %RomName%, Down_Count, 0
Run, awdemul.exe
WinWait, DEMUL,
;WinHide, DEMUL,
IfWinNotActive, DEMUL, , WinActivate, DEMUL,
WinWaitActive, DEMUL,
Send, {ALTDOWN}f{ALTUP}{DOWN}{DOWN}{ENTER}
WinWait, Select ROM, Cancel
IfWinNotActive, Select ROM, Cancel, WinActivate, Select ROM, Cancel
WinWaitActive, Select ROM, Cancel
Send, {DOWN %num_down%}
Send, {ALTDOWN}{ENTER}{ALTUP}
Send, {ENTER}
Sleep, 7000 ; Gives time for loading to finish before unhiding desktop
Send, {f8}
Sleep, 2000
Gui Destroy
Blockinput off ; Allows user to send inputs so games can be played
Process, WaitClose, awdemul.exe
Winshow ahk_class Shell_TrayWnd
Winshow Start ahk_class Button
ExitAPP

Link to comment
Share on other sites

Guest
This topic is now closed to further replies.

×
×
  • Create New...